FAQs on IIT Ropar Placements 2025: Latest Statistics, Trends, and Insights
1. What are the latest IIT Ropar placements statistics?
The IIT Ropar placements 2024 recorded a 73.49% placement rate for BTech students, with an average package of INR 22.09 LPA. Top recruiters included Google, Amazon, Microsoft, and Intel.
2. What is the IIT Ropar CSE average package for the previous year?
The IIT Ropar CSE average package in 2024 was INR 22.09 LPA, making it one of the highest-paying branches at the institute.
3. What is the IIT Ropar average package for last year?
The IIT Ropar average package in 2024 stood at INR 22.09 LPA for BTech and INR 11.96 LPA for MTech/MSc programs.
4. What is the IIT Ropar highest package offered in 2024?
The IIT Ropar highest package in 2024 was INR 2.05 Crore (international offer) and INR 1.5 Crore (domestic offer).
5. What is the IIT Ropar mechanical average package for last year?
The IIT Ropar mechanical average package for 2024 has not been officially disclosed, but previous trends suggest it falls between INR 16-19 LPA.
6. What is the IIT Ropar electrical engineering average package in 2024?
The IIT Ropar electrical engineering average package in 2024 was INR 22.1 LPA, showing a steady rise compared to previous years.
7. What is the IIT Ropar chemical engineering average package ?
The IIT Ropar chemical engineering average package for 2024 was approximately INR 19.43 LPA, based on recent placement reports.
8. How do IIT Ropar placements compare with other IITs?
The IIT Ropar placements have seen steady growth, with its BTech CSE average package on par with mid-tier IITs and top recruiters participating every year.
9. Which companies participated in IIT Ropar placements?
IIT Ropar placements in 2024 saw participation from Google, Amazon, Microsoft, Uber, Deloitte, Oracle, Intel, and Zomato, among others.
